对抗雷达网最优电子战布阵研究

Research on Optimized Electronic Warfare Embattling Countermining Radar Net

Abstract:In order to investigate how to embattle electronic warfare(EW) to get certain width of safe corridor,the safe corridor conception is put forward and its width is used as the jamming index of performance measurement.Firstly,the conception of radar detecting area in real terrain is given,and the solution to get safe corridor width using mathematical morphology is brought forward.Secondly,both the restriction of safe corridor and the safe of electronic jamming plane are taken into full consideration,the optimal EW embattling model is built,and the resolution using genetic algorithm is given as well.At last,a simulation example is offered.Whose results show that the way to get safe corridor width works perfectly and the optimal model is right.
